Job Description

SUMMARY

The Affordable Housing Operations Fellow will be a member of the HHDC Property Management team. This is a full-time paid internship that provides a unique opportunity to gain hands-on experience in the management of multifamily affordable housing, with exposure to key property management functions including administration, maintenance oversight, marketing and leasing, resident and community relations and financial reporting and control. This position will assist the Vice President of Property Management by performing assigned tasks related to the day-to-day operations of the HHDC portfolio. The fellow will also have an opportunity to develop inter-personal and administrative skills that are essential to successful property management professionals. 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S include the following. Other duties may be assigned.
  • Assist VP of Property Management with assigned tasks to assist with property management administration, including clerical assistance, file maintenance, data entry
  • Assisting the tracking of physical asset maintenance, including tracking work orders and other monitoring duties
  • Support the marketing and leasing team with administrative and reporting duties
  • Assist with planning, organizing and implementing resident activities
  • Special projects assigned by AVP of Property Management
  • Other duties as assigned
